Alterior Motives With Sarah Palin's Resignation?
Governor Sarah Palin announced, Friday, that she will step down as Alaska's chief executive by the end of the month. She added that she will not seek election to a second gubernatorial term in 2010.  During her speech she said, "Only a dead fish goes with the flow." 

According to CNN, a Republican source close to her said that it was a "calculation" she made that "it was time to move on." The source also said that Palin's "book deal and other issues" were "causing a lot of friction" in Alaska.  It's speculated that she is "mapping out a path to 2012."

Palin, who was the 2008 Republican vice presidential nominee, has been thought of as one of the 'lead-cards' for the GOP nomination in 2012.

Her decision to step down as governor speaks to the speculation that she might just be planning to run for the White House.

How To Get Tickets To Michael Jackson's Memorial
Jackson family spokesperson Ken Sunshine and AEG CEO Tim Leiweke met at a news conference Friday to discuss the arrangements that have been made to commemorate Michael Jackson.

Who: Winners selected by entering at staplescenter.com.

What: Memorial Service

When: Tuesday, July 7 at 10AM

Where: Staples Center (live), Nokia theater (simulcast on three screens) in Los Angeles, CA.

There are 17,500 tickets available. There will be 11,000 tickets given out for people to attend the service inside the Staples Center.  6,500 tickets for people to view the service from a simulcast at the Nokia theater, and 9,000 tickets have been given to the Jackson family to use at their discretion.

Fans have had trouble registering due to the amount of traffic the site has experienced in such a short period of time.  Be patient!

The winners will be drawn and will receive a code for ticketmaster, they will be notified on Sunday between 11AM and 8PM.  Winners will need to arrive at the Staples Center on Monday morning to pick up two tickets and two wristbands.
 
You must get the tickets this way because distribution of tickets at the Staples Center or Nokia theatre will not be available. Also, if you are not selected as a winner it is recommended that you watch the memorial from your home as no crowds will be allowed to accumulate outside of the Staples Center.
 
"No details forthcoming about memorial, it's still being developed," Ken Sunshine, Jackson family spokesperson, told reporters.

Brad Pitt Hitches A Ride With The Paps

While cruising Franklin Village Thursday, Brad Pitt's vintage motorcyle decided it would be a good time to break down.

Already late for a meeting, the 45-year-old actor, quickly decided to hop in the car of an unsuspecting shutter-bug.

Once in the car, it's pretty clear that Pitt wanted out, after being bombarded with questions by the persistant photog in the back.

Lucky for Brad, it only took a few blocks until they returned him to his Los Feliz home.  There's no place like home.
